Jim Morrison bust found in France, 37 years after theft

37 years after it was stolen from a Paris cemetery. The sculpture, missing since 1988, was found during a search tied to a fraud case led by the Paris public prosecutor's office, a source close to the investigation said. Nostalgic rock fans still flock to Morrison's grave at Paris's Pere Lachaise cemetery, where he was buried after his death in the French capital in 1971 at the age of 27.The sculpture, by Croatian artistMladen Mikulin, had been placed at the grave to mark the 10th anniversary of Morrison's death.
